Adding a DIY glycol chiller setup to my fermentation system, mostly based off of several other projects i've found on this forum.

Question. Envisioning tubing connecting from the chiller setup to the SSbrewtech chiller tube connections on fermenter and the glycol running through it. When i need to move either the chiller setup or fermenter i envision a need to disconnect the lines from the chiller to the fermentation chamber but i dont want to lose or need to drain any of the glycol running through the system.

Outside of having two shutoff valves inline and a quick disconnect between them is there such a thing as a quick disconnect connect that can be pulled apart without losing(self sealing in a way) fluid after the disconnect?

I read on another posting about "leak-stop quick disconnects", they appear to be a plastic solution that accomplishes this task but i am unable to find them anywhere in my searches.
